Cummins KTAA19-G6 vs Volvo Penta TAD1642GE-B

The Cummins KTAA19-G6 and Volvo Penta TAD1642GE-B are both diesel generator engines in a similar power class. Both are rated at roughly 651 kVA. Displacement is 19 L versus 16.1 L. The table below compares their full specifications side by side.

SpecificationCummins KTAA19-G6Volvo Penta TAD1642GE-B
Headline rating650 kVA651 kVA
Standby (50 Hz)520 kWe521 kWe
Prime (50 Hz)460 kWe473 kWe
Standby (60 Hz)550 kWe
Prime (60 Hz)500 kWe
Displacement19 L16.1 L
ConfigurationL6L6
Cylinders66
Rated speed1,500 RPM1,500 / 1,800 RPM
FuelDieselDiesel
CoolingLiquid-CooledLiquid-Cooled
EmissionsUnregulatedEuro Stage II / U.S. EPA Tier 2
Dry weight
OriginChinaSweden

Choosing between Cummins KTAA19-G6 and Volvo Penta TAD1642GE-B

Use this comparison as an engineering shortlist, then confirm the complete generator package against load profile, voltage, 50/60 Hz frequency, duty class, emissions rules, cooling margin, altitude, ambient temperature, enclosure design, controller features, and alternator sizing. The Volvo Penta TAD1642GE-B has the higher headline kVA rating in this pair, but site conditions and duty cycle can still change the final recommendation.
